Connect Skyvern to n8n's open-source automation platform. Trigger browser automations from any workflow, or pipe Skyvern's results into downstream nodes.
## Available Operations
- **Task → Dispatch a Task** — Run a browser automation with a prompt
- **Task → Get a Task** — Retrieve results from a previously run task
- **Workflow → Dispatch a Workflow Run** — Run a pre-built Skyvern workflow with parameters
- **Workflow → Get a Workflow Run** — Retrieve results from a previously run workflow
## Setup
Create a new workflow or edit an existing one, click **+**, search for "Skyvern", and click *Install* → *Add to workflow*.
Click *Select credential* → "Create new credential" and paste your API key from [Settings](https://app.skyvern.com/settings/api-keys).
Fill in the fields for your chosen operation. See the field reference below.
Run the workflow and monitor progress in your [Skyvern dashboard](https://app.skyvern.com).
## Field reference
### Dispatch a Task
- **User Prompt** (required) — What Skyvern should do
- **URL** — The starting page. If omitted, Skyvern navigates based on the prompt.
- **Webhook Callback URL** — URL to notify when the task finishes
Under **Task Options**:
- **Engine** — Defaults to **Skyvern 2.0**.
- **Skyvern 1.0** — Simple, single-step tasks
- **Skyvern 2.0** — Complex, multi-step goals with dynamic planning
- **OpenAI CUA** / **Anthropic CUA** — Third-party computer-use agents
### Dispatch a Workflow Run
First, create your workflow in the [Skyvern UI](https://app.skyvern.com).
- **Workflow Name or ID** (required) — Select from the dropdown or specify an ID with an expression
- **Workflow Run Parameters** — Loaded dynamically from the selected workflow
- **Webhook Callback URL** — URL to notify when the workflow finishes
### Get a Task
- **Task ID** (required) — The ID of the task run
### Get a Workflow Run
- **Workflow Name or ID** (required) — Select the workflow from the dropdown
- **Workflow Run ID** (required) — Starts with `wr_`
